Griswold Scout Reservation (GSR) is a 3,500-acre (14 km 2) reservation for Scouting located near Gilmanton Ironworks, New Hampshire, and operated by the New Hampshire Council of the Boy Scouts of America. It comprises two camps, Hidden Valley Scout Camp and Camp Bell, which both run an eight-week summer camping program.

Kansas Lake is a lake in Watonwan County, in the U.S. state of Minnesota. [ 1 ] Kansas Lake was not named after the state of Kansas ; instead the name is a corruption of "Kensie's Lake", in honor of John Kensie, an English settler.
Central Minnesota Council is home to Parker Scout Reservation, which was established in 1941 by Clyde Parker. The Camp sits on 256 acres (1.0 km 2 ) of wooded land on North Long Lake north of Brainerd , Minnesota.
Pfeffer Scout Reservation (PSR) is located on the shores of Kentucky Lake near Aurora. It was formerly named Camp Roy C. Manchester. From 1973 to 1983, PSR took advantage of Scouting America’s attempt to create regional Outdoor Adventure ("High Adventure") bases around the nation.
